[One-Verse Meditation]
1 Samuel 20:1 (NIV) Then David fled from Naioth at Ramah and went to Jonathan and asked, “What have I done? What is my crime? How have I wronged your father, that he is trying to kill me?”
[Meditation]
Fleeing from Saul who seeks to kill him, David escapes to Naioth in Ramah. Saul sends messengers three times to capture David, but when the Spirit of God comes upon them, they forget their original mission and prophesy. (This should be seen not as typical prophecy, but as God’s supernatural work to incapacitate them.)
Eventually, Saul goes himself, but he too is seized by the Spirit of God and collapses in disgrace, stripped of his robes. In that gap, David escapes, finds his friend Jonathan, and pours out his despairing heart: “What have I done? What is my crime? How have I wronged your father, that he is trying to kill me?”
In this verse, we get a glimpse into David’s heart. It is a protest and a lament: “Why must I, who have done nothing wrong, suffer this ordeal?” When unexpected and undesired events unfold before us, contrary to our hopes and plans, we too feel this way: “Lord, what is all this?”
Herein lies the work of the Lord. From that place of faithlessness, the Lord raises us up. “Not at all! You will not die.” Although these words come from Jonathan’s heart to comfort David, the Lord uses even this to do His work. The eye that sees this work of God unfolding in everyday life is faith.
[Prayer]
Lord, You turn all my moments into good. You use even my sighs and despair, worries and complaints, as material for faith in You. Therefore I, who have nothing to boast of, sing only of You. May my walk today be one of praising You with a new song. Amen.
